Tasksel ubuntu что это такое
Обновлено: 21.11.2024
Tasksel — это еще один способ установить несколько пакетов в Ubuntu или Debian или их производных. Это не похоже на apt или aptitude, которые устанавливают один пакет вместо всего пакета. Например, вы хотите установить сервер LAMP на свой сервер или рабочий стол, поэтому, используя apt, вам придется выполнить несколько команд или экземпляров в одной команде, чтобы получить Apache, MySQL и PHP в вашей системе для настройки веб-сервера. Однако, если в вашей системе есть инструмент Tasksel на несколько килобайт, вам просто нужно ввести одну команду, и он сразу же установит весь сервер LAMP вместе со своими зависимостями.
Кроме того, Tasksel не ограничивается только сервером LAMP, но также предоставляет среды рабочего стола (GNOME, KDE, LXDE, MATE и т. д.), DNS-сервер, сервер печати, сервер SSH, сервер Tomcat Java и многое другое... Здесь мы покажем, как для установки Tasksel в системе на основе Ubuntu или Debian.
Шаг 1. Доступ к командному терминалу
Если вы работаете на сервере Ubuntu или Debian, вы уже находитесь на командном экране, однако пользователь рабочего стола может просто использовать ярлык терминала, например CTRL+ALT+T, или использовать клавишу Super/клавишу Windows, чтобы открыть действия и выполнить поиск терминал там.
Шаг 2. Установите Tasksel в Ubuntu или Debian
Здесь мы используем Ubuntu 19.04 для установки Tasksel, однако шаги и дальнейшее использование этого инструмента будут одинаковыми для Debian, Kali Linux, Linux Mint, Elementary OS, Ubuntu 8.04/16.04/14.06… и других их производных. ОС Linux.
Команда для установки Tasksel:
Шаг 3. Просмотрите доступные пакеты Tasksel для установки
Прежде чем перейти к установке любого пакета или задачи с помощью Tasksel, вы можете проверить, какие пакеты доступны? Для этого используйте следующую команду:
Для Ubuntu мы находим все эти задачи или программные пакеты на Tasksel для установки:
Kubuntu-live, Lubuntu-live, ubuntu-budgie-live; Live CD с Ubuntu, Live CD с Ubuntu MATE; Живой DVD Ubuntu Studio; живой компакт-диск Xubuntu; облачный образ Ubuntu, DNS-сервер; Рабочий стол Кубунту; Полный Kubuntu, сервер LAMP, рабочий стол Lubuntu, база данных PostgreSQL, файловый сервер Samba, рабочий стол Ubuntu Budgie, рабочий стол Ubuntu, языки рабочего стола Ubuntu по умолчанию; минимальный рабочий стол Ubuntu; Минимальные языки рабочего стола Ubuntu по умолчанию; Ubuntu MATE минимальный; Рабочий стол Ubuntu MATE; Ubuntustudio-аудио; Рабочий стол Ubuntu Studio; Минимальная установка DE Ubuntu Studio; Большой выбор пакетов шрифтов; Ubuntustudio-graphics 2D/3D пакет для создания и редактирования, Ubuntustudio-фотография
Ubuntustudio-publishing; Минимальная установка Xubuntu, OpenSSH-сервер OpenSSH-сервер; Базовый сервер Ubuntu, включая еще несколько…
Шаг 4. Интерактивная установка пакетов Taskel
Если вы хотите установить какой-либо из стеков пакетов программного обеспечения, отображаемых в вашем списке задач Tasksel, вы можете либо использовать форму команды, указанную на следующем шаге, либо просто ввести Tasksel, и откроется простой интерактивный интерфейс для установки нескольких пакетов. р>
Перейдите к нужному пакету с помощью клавиш со стрелками и нажмите клавишу пробела, чтобы выбрать пакет. Мы можем выбрать несколько программ, чтобы установить их одновременно, не запуская команду Tasksel снова и снова.
Шаг 5. Используйте команду Tasksel для установки программного обеспечения
Выше мы уже видели, что мы можем использовать интерактивный метод для установки пакетов, однако вы все еще хотите использовать команду, тогда вот она:
Более того, даже после установки Tasksel в системе мы можем использовать наш собственный apt-get для установки программных стеков или задач, доступных в этом инструменте.
Для получения дополнительной информации см. следующий шаг…
Например, установка сервера Tasksel LAMP
Итак, сначала перечислите все доступные программы и пакеты
Теперь, если вы хотите установить сервер LAMP, команда будет выглядеть так:
Примечание. Если вы используете apt для установки пакетов Tasksel, не забудьте поставить заглавную букву (^) в конце команды.
Кроме того, phpMyAdmin отсутствует в Tasksel, поэтому после установки LAMP; если вам нужен phpMyAdmin, просто введите команду ниже, используя apt:
Удалить установленные задачи или пакеты Tasksel
В дальнейшем, если вы хотите удалить какое-либо программное обеспечение или задачи, установленные этим инструментом, используйте следующую команду:
Как видите, на предыдущем шаге мы установили сервер Lamp с помощью команды, которую теперь используем для его удаления
Для пользователей Debian или любого другого дистрибутива Linux на основе этого вы редактируете список задач Tasksel, чтобы добавлять задачи вручную:
.имя файла desc зависит от того, какой дистрибутив Linux вы используете.
Удалить сам Tasksel
Ну! все не идеально, и в дальнейшем, когда вы решите, что вам больше не нужен этот инструмент на вашем ПК с Ubuntu/Debian, введите приведенную ниже команду, чтобы удалить его.
Одной из нескольких задач, с которыми приходится сталкиваться пользователю Linux, является установка программного обеспечения. Возможно, есть два метода, особенно в системах Debian/Ubuntu Linux, которые вы можете использовать для установки программного обеспечения. Первый — это установка отдельных пакетов с помощью инструментов управления пакетами, таких как apt-get, apt, aptitude и synaptic.
Другой способ — использование Tasksel — простого и удобного в использовании инструмента, разработанного для Debian/Ubuntu, который предоставляет пользователям интерфейс, позволяющий им устанавливать группу связанных пакетов, таких как LAMP Server, Mail Server, DNS Server. и т. д. в виде одной предварительно настроенной задачи. Он работает аналогично мета-пакетам, вы найдете почти все задачи в tasksel, присутствующие в мета-пакетах.
Как установить и использовать Tasksel в Debian и Ubuntu
Чтобы установить tasksel, просто выполните следующую команду:
После установки Tasksel вы можете установить одну или несколько предопределенных групп пакетов. Пользователю необходимо запустить его из командной строки с несколькими аргументами, он также предоставляет графический интерфейс пользователя, где можно выбрать программное обеспечение для установки.
Общий синтаксис запуска tasksel из командной строки:
Чтобы запустить пользовательский интерфейс tasksel, введите следующую команду:
Если вы видите звездочку (*) без красного маркера, это означает, что программное обеспечение уже установлено.
Чтобы установить одно или несколько программ, используйте стрелки вверх и вниз для перемещения красного маркера, нажмите клавишу пробела, чтобы выбрать программу, и с помощью клавиши Tab переместите значок на . Затем нажмите кнопку Enter, чтобы установить выбранное программное обеспечение, как показано на скриншоте ниже.
Кроме того, вы также можете вывести список всех задач из командной строки, используя приведенную ниже команду. Обратите внимание, что в первом столбце списка u (неустановлено) означает, что программное обеспечение не установлено, а i (установлено) означает, что оно установлено.
Пример вывода
Полное описание всех задач можно найти в файлах /usr/share/tasksel/*.desc и /usr/local/share/tasksel/*.desc.
Давайте установим некоторую группу программных пакетов, таких как LAMP, Mail Server, DNS Server и т. д.
Установка стека LAMP с помощью Tasksel
Вы можете использовать либо пользовательский интерфейс, либо параметр командной строки, но здесь мы будем использовать параметр командной строки следующим образом:
Во время установки пакета Mysql вам будет предложено настроить Mysql, установив пароль root. Просто введите надежный и безопасный пароль, а затем нажмите клавишу Enter, чтобы продолжить.
Дождитесь завершения установки. После того, как все будет сделано, вы можете протестировать установку стека LAMP следующим образом.
Аналогичным образом вы также можете установить почтовый сервер или DNS-сервер, как показано ниже:
Посмотрите справочную страницу пакета tasksel, чтобы узнать о дополнительных возможностях использования.
В заключение, tasksel — это простой и удобный интерфейс для пользователей, позволяющий устанавливать программное обеспечение на свои системы Debian/Ubuntu Linux.
Однако какой метод установки программного обеспечения, т. е. использование инструментов управления пакетами apt-get/apt/aptitude или tasksel, вы предпочитаете и почему? Дайте нам знать через раздел комментариев ниже, а также любые предложения или другие важные отзывы.
Если вам понравилась эта статья, подпишитесь на уведомления по электронной почте о руководствах по Linux. Если у вас есть вопросы или сомнения? обратитесь за помощью в разделе комментариев.
Если вы цените то, что мы делаем здесь, в TecMint, вам следует подумать о следующем:
TecMint – это самый быстрорастущий и пользующийся наибольшим доверием сайт сообщества, где можно найти любые статьи, руководства и книги по Linux в Интернете. Миллионы людей посещают TecMint! для поиска или просмотра тысяч опубликованных статей, доступных всем БЕСПЛАТНО.
Если вам нравится то, что вы читаете, купите нам кофе (или 2) в знак признательности.
Мы благодарны за вашу бесконечную поддержку.
Похожие сообщения
3 мысли о «Tasksel — простая и быстрая групповая установка программного обеспечения в Debian и Ubuntu»
Если я открою терминал изнутри USB-накопителя, можно ли будет установить туда программы? Будет ли он загрузочным, если я положу установку live CD в корневую папку диска. Спасибо за урок между. Я новичок..
какой-нибудь способ создать индивидуальные задачи?
Да, вы можете создавать индивидуальные задачи, мы как можно скорее создадим для этого руководство.
Есть что сказать? Присоединяйтесь к обсуждению. Отменить ответ
Этот сайт использует Akismet для уменьшения количества спама. Узнайте, как обрабатываются данные ваших комментариев.
Tasksel – это инструмент Debian/Ubuntu, который позволяет вам устанавливать несколько связанных пакетов в качестве скоординированных "задач" на ваш сервер. Например, вместо того, чтобы идти шаг за шагом и устанавливать каждую часть стека LAMP, вы можете попросить Tasksel установить все части стека LAMP за вас одним нажатием клавиши.
Должен ли я использовать Tasksel?
tasksel более эффективен при обработке и выборе задач. Может выполнять дополнительные скрипты до/после установки/удаления задач. И самое большое преимущество: вы можете очень легко изменять задачи и создавать новые. Невозможно редактировать официальный файл со списком пакетов без недостатков (действительная подпись).
Что такое пакет Tasksel?
Пакет Tasksel предоставляет простой интерфейс для пользователей, которые хотят настроить свою систему для выполнения определенной задачи. Эта программа используется в процессе установки, но пользователи также могут использовать tasksel в любое время.
Что такое Debian Tasksel?
Tasksel – это инструмент для систем на основе Debian, позволяющий установить несколько связанных пакетов в качестве скоординированной "задачи" в вашей системе. Это обеспечивает простой способ настроить сервер для конкретной цели. Например, вам нужно настроить свой сервер как сервер веб-хостинга на базе LAMP.
Как получить графический интерфейс в Ubuntu?
Как установить рабочий стол на сервер Ubuntu
- Войдите на сервер.
- Введите команду «sudo apt-get update», чтобы обновить список доступных программных пакетов.
- Введите команду «sudo apt-get install ubuntu-desktop», чтобы установить рабочий стол Gnome.
Кубунту быстрее, чем Ubuntu?
Эта функция похожа на собственную функцию поиска Unity, только она намного быстрее, чем та, что предлагает Ubuntu. Без сомнения, Kubuntu более отзывчива и в целом «чувствует себя» быстрее, чем Ubuntu. И Ubuntu, и Kubuntu используют dpkg для управления пакетами.
Какой Tasksel установить?
Tasksel – это инструмент Debian/Ubuntu, который устанавливает несколько связанных пакетов в виде скоординированной «задачи» в вашу систему.
Как получить Таскел?
Установка задач
- Откройте окно терминала.
- Введите команду sudo apt-get install tasksel.
- Введите пароль sudo и нажмите клавишу Enter.
- Если будет предложено, введите «y», чтобы продолжить.
- Дождитесь завершения установки.
В чем разница между apt install и apt-get install?
apt-get может рассматриваться как низкоуровневый и «внутренний» и поддерживает другие инструменты на основе APT. apt предназначен для конечных пользователей (людей), и его вывод может быть изменен между версиями. Примечание от apt(8): команда `apt` предназначена для удобства конечных пользователей и не требует обратной совместимости, как apt-get(8).
Есть ли у Ubuntu Server графический интерфейс?
Ubuntu Server не имеет графического интерфейса, но его можно установить дополнительно.
Что такое Kubuntu full?
<р>0. kubuntu-full — это всего лишь метапакет, который включает в себя больше программного обеспечения, чем kubuntu-desktop. Вместо того, чтобы устанавливать только необходимое программное обеспечение для обычного пользователя, он устанавливает большую часть пакета KDE. Еще один пакет, который вы можете изучить, это kde-full. Кроме того, НЕ устанавливайте kubuntu-full с помощью графической установки.Что такое стандартные системные утилиты Debian?
В нем будет указано, что входит в «стандартные системные утилиты»:
- apt-listchanges.
- lsof.
- mlocate.
- w3m.
- в.
- libswitch-perl.
- xz-utils.
- телнет.
Для чего хорош Xubuntu?
Xubuntu – это разработанная сообществом операционная система, которая сочетает в себе элегантность и простоту использования.… Xubuntu идеально подходит для тех, кто хочет получить максимальную отдачу от своих настольных компьютеров, ноутбуков и нетбуков с современным внешним видом и достаточным количеством функций для эффективного ежедневного использования. Он хорошо работает и на старом оборудовании.
В этом руководстве мы покажем вам, как установить Tasksel в Ubuntu 20.04 LTS. Для тех из вас, кто не знал, Tasksel — это инструмент Ubuntu, который позволяет вам устанавливать несколько связанных пакетов в качестве скоординированных «задач» на ваш сервер. Таким образом, вместо того, чтобы устанавливать пакеты один за другим, скажем, для стека LAMP, вы можете установить стек LAMP за один раз, так как Tasksel группирует пакеты вместе.
В этой статье предполагается, что у вас есть хотя бы базовые знания о Linux, умение пользоваться оболочкой и, самое главное, размещение сайта на собственном VPS. Установка довольно проста и предполагает, что вы работаете с учетной записью root, в противном случае вам может потребоваться добавить « sudo » к командам, чтобы получить привилегии root. Я покажу вам пошаговую установку Tasksel на Ubuntu 20.04 (Focal Fossa). Вы можете следовать тем же инструкциям для Ubuntu 18.04, 16.04 и любого другого дистрибутива на основе Debian, такого как Linux Mint.
Установите Tasksel в Ubuntu 20.04 LTS Focal Fossa
Шаг 1. Сначала убедитесь, что все ваши системные пакеты обновлены, выполнив в терминале следующие команды apt.
Шаг 2. Установка Tasksel в Ubuntu 20.04.
По умолчанию Tasksel доступен в базовом репозитории Ubuntu. Теперь выполните следующую команду ниже, чтобы установить его:
После успешной установки, чтобы открыть пользовательский интерфейс для установки программных приложений, введите следующую команду ниже:
Чтобы установить одно или несколько программ, используйте стрелки вверх и вниз для перемещения красного маркера, нажмите клавишу пробела, чтобы выбрать программу, и используйте клавишу Tab, чтобы переместить их на .
Чтобы просмотреть список всех предопределенных пакетов программного обеспечения, используйте --list-task :
Поздравляем! Вы успешно установили Tasksel. Спасибо за использование этого руководства по установке системы Tasksel Ubuntu 20.04 LTS Focal Fossa. Для получения дополнительной помощи или полезной информации мы рекомендуем вам посетить официальный веб-сайт Tasksel.
Если у вас нет времени заниматься всем этим или если это не ваша область знаний, мы предлагаем услугу «Управление VPS», начиная с 10 долларов США (оплата через PayPal). Пожалуйста, свяжитесь с нами, чтобы получить лучшее предложение!
Читайте также: